~ [ source navigation ] ~ [ diff markup ] ~ [ identifier search ] ~

TOMOYO Linux Cross Reference
Linux/fs/nfs/Kconfig

Version: ~ [ linux-6.12-rc7 ] ~ [ linux-6.11.7 ] ~ [ linux-6.10.14 ] ~ [ linux-6.9.12 ] ~ [ linux-6.8.12 ] ~ [ linux-6.7.12 ] ~ [ linux-6.6.60 ] ~ [ linux-6.5.13 ] ~ [ linux-6.4.16 ] ~ [ linux-6.3.13 ] ~ [ linux-6.2.16 ] ~ [ linux-6.1.116 ] ~ [ linux-6.0.19 ] ~ [ linux-5.19.17 ] ~ [ linux-5.18.19 ] ~ [ linux-5.17.15 ] ~ [ linux-5.16.20 ] ~ [ linux-5.15.171 ] ~ [ linux-5.14.21 ] ~ [ linux-5.13.19 ] ~ [ linux-5.12.19 ] ~ [ linux-5.11.22 ] ~ [ linux-5.10.229 ] ~ [ linux-5.9.16 ] ~ [ linux-5.8.18 ] ~ [ linux-5.7.19 ] ~ [ linux-5.6.19 ] ~ [ linux-5.5.19 ] ~ [ linux-5.4.285 ] ~ [ linux-5.3.18 ] ~ [ linux-5.2.21 ] ~ [ linux-5.1.21 ] ~ [ linux-5.0.21 ] ~ [ linux-4.20.17 ] ~ [ linux-4.19.323 ] ~ [ linux-4.18.20 ] ~ [ linux-4.17.19 ] ~ [ linux-4.16.18 ] ~ [ linux-4.15.18 ] ~ [ linux-4.14.336 ] ~ [ linux-4.13.16 ] ~ [ linux-4.12.14 ] ~ [ linux-4.11.12 ] ~ [ linux-4.10.17 ] ~ [ linux-4.9.337 ] ~ [ linux-4.4.302 ] ~ [ linux-3.10.108 ] ~ [ linux-2.6.32.71 ] ~ [ linux-2.6.0 ] ~ [ linux-2.4.37.11 ] ~ [ unix-v6-master ] ~ [ ccs-tools-1.8.12 ] ~ [ policy-sample ] ~
Architecture: ~ [ i386 ] ~ [ alpha ] ~ [ m68k ] ~ [ mips ] ~ [ ppc ] ~ [ sparc ] ~ [ sparc64 ] ~

Diff markup

Differences between /fs/nfs/Kconfig (Version linux-6.12-rc7) and /fs/nfs/Kconfig (Version linux-2.6.0)


  1 # SPDX-License-Identifier: GPL-2.0-only           
  2 config NFS_FS                                     
  3         tristate "NFS client support"             
  4         depends on INET && FILE_LOCKING && MUL    
  5         select LOCKD                              
  6         select SUNRPC                             
  7         select NFS_COMMON                         
  8         select NFS_ACL_SUPPORT if NFS_V3_ACL      
  9         help                                      
 10           Choose Y here if you want to access     
 11           computers using Sun's Network File S    
 12           this file system support as a module    
 13           will be called nfs.                     
 14                                                   
 15           To mount file systems exported by NF    
 16           install the user space mount.nfs com    
 17           the Linux nfs-utils package, availab    
 18           Information about using the mount co    
 19           mount(8) man page.  More detail abou    
 20           implementation is available via the     
 21                                                   
 22           Below you can choose which versions     
 23           available in the kernel to mount NFS    
 24           version 2 (RFC 1094) is always avail    
 25                                                   
 26           To configure a system which mounts i    
 27           at boot time, say Y here, select "Ke    
 28           autoconfiguration" in the NETWORK me    
 29           system on NFS" below.  You cannot co    
 30           module in this case.                    
 31                                                   
 32           If unsure, say N.                       
 33                                                   
 34 config NFS_V2                                     
 35         tristate "NFS client support for NFS v    
 36         depends on NFS_FS                         
 37         default n                                 
 38         help                                      
 39           This option enables support for vers    
 40           (RFC 1094) in the kernel's NFS clien    
 41                                                   
 42           If unsure, say N.                       
 43                                                   
 44 config NFS_V3                                     
 45         tristate "NFS client support for NFS v    
 46         depends on NFS_FS                         
 47         default y                                 
 48         help                                      
 49           This option enables support for vers    
 50           (RFC 1813) in the kernel's NFS clien    
 51                                                   
 52           If unsure, say Y.                       
 53                                                   
 54 config NFS_V3_ACL                                 
 55         bool "NFS client support for the NFSv3    
 56         depends on NFS_V3                         
 57         help                                      
 58           Some NFS servers support an auxiliar    
 59           Sun added to Solaris but never becam    
 60           NFS version 3 protocol.  This protoc    
 61           applications on NFS clients to manip    
 62           Lists on files residing on NFS serve    
 63           ACLs on local files whether this pro    
 64                                                   
 65           Choose Y here if your NFS server sup    
 66           protocol extension and you want your    
 67           applications to access and modify AC    
 68                                                   
 69           Most NFS servers don't support the S    
 70           extension.  You can choose N here or    
 71           option to prevent your NFS client fr    
 72           ACL protocol.                           
 73                                                   
 74           If unsure, say N.                       
 75                                                   
 76 config NFS_V4                                     
 77         tristate "NFS client support for NFS v    
 78         depends on NFS_FS                         
 79         select KEYS                               
 80         help                                      
 81           This option enables support for vers    
 82           (RFC 3530) in the kernel's NFS clien    
 83                                                   
 84           To mount NFS servers using NFSv4, yo    
 85           space programs which can be found in    
 86           available from http://linux-nfs.org/    
 87                                                   
 88           If unsure, say Y.                       
 89                                                   
 90 config NFS_SWAP                                   
 91         bool "Provide swap over NFS support"      
 92         default n                                 
 93         depends on NFS_FS && SWAP                 
 94         select SUNRPC_SWAP                        
 95         help                                      
 96           This option enables swapon to work o    
 97                                                   
 98 config NFS_V4_1                                   
 99         bool "NFS client support for NFSv4.1"     
100         depends on NFS_V4                         
101         select SUNRPC_BACKCHANNEL                 
102         help                                      
103           This option enables support for mino    
104           (RFC 5661) in the kernel's NFS clien    
105                                                   
106           If unsure, say N.                       
107                                                   
108 config NFS_V4_2                                   
109         bool "NFS client support for NFSv4.2"     
110         depends on NFS_V4_1                       
111         help                                      
112           This option enables support for mino    
113           in the kernel's NFS client.             
114                                                   
115           If unsure, say N.                       
116                                                   
117 config PNFS_FILE_LAYOUT                           
118         tristate                                  
119         depends on NFS_V4_1                       
120         default NFS_V4                            
121                                                   
122 config PNFS_BLOCK                                 
123         tristate                                  
124         depends on NFS_V4_1 && BLK_DEV_DM         
125         default NFS_V4                            
126                                                   
127 config PNFS_FLEXFILE_LAYOUT                       
128         tristate                                  
129         depends on NFS_V4_1                       
130         default NFS_V4                            
131                                                   
132 config NFS_V4_1_IMPLEMENTATION_ID_DOMAIN          
133         string "NFSv4.1 Implementation ID Doma    
134         depends on NFS_V4_1                       
135         default "kernel.org"                      
136         help                                      
137           This option defines the domain porti    
138           may be sent in the NFS exchange_id o    
139           the format of a DNS domain name and     
140           name of the distribution.               
141           If the NFS client is unchanged from     
142           option should be set to the default     
143                                                   
144 config NFS_V4_1_MIGRATION                         
145         bool "NFSv4.1 client support for migra    
146         depends on NFS_V4_1                       
147         default n                                 
148         help                                      
149           This option makes the NFS client adv    
150           it can support NFSv4 migration.         
151                                                   
152           The NFSv4.1 pieces of the Linux NFSv    
153           still experimental.  If you are not     
154                                                   
155 config NFS_V4_SECURITY_LABEL                      
156         bool                                      
157         depends on NFS_V4_2 && SECURITY           
158         default y                                 
159                                                   
160 config ROOT_NFS                                   
161         bool "Root file system on NFS"            
162         depends on NFS_FS=y && IP_PNP             
163         help                                      
164           If you want your system to mount its    
165           choose Y here.  This is common pract    
166           without local permanent storage.  Fo    
167           <file:Documentation/admin-guide/nfs/    
168                                                   
169           Most people say N here.                 
170                                                   
171 config NFS_FSCACHE                                
172         bool "Provide NFS client caching suppo    
173         depends on NFS_FS=m && NETFS_SUPPORT |    
174         select FSCACHE                            
175         help                                      
176           Say Y here if you want NFS data to b    
177           the general filesystem cache manager    
178                                                   
179 config NFS_USE_LEGACY_DNS                         
180         bool "Use the legacy NFS DNS resolver"    
181         depends on NFS_V4                         
182         help                                      
183           The kernel now provides a method for    
184           IP address.  Select Y here if you wo    
185           resolver script.                        
186                                                   
187           If unsure, say N                        
188                                                   
189 config NFS_USE_KERNEL_DNS                         
190         bool                                      
191         depends on NFS_V4 && !NFS_USE_LEGACY_D    
192         select DNS_RESOLVER                       
193         default y                                 
194                                                   
195 config NFS_DEBUG                                  
196         bool                                      
197         depends on NFS_FS && SUNRPC_DEBUG         
198         select CRC32                              
199         default y                                 
200                                                   
201 config NFS_DISABLE_UDP_SUPPORT                    
202        bool "NFS: Disable NFS UDP protocol sup    
203        depends on NFS_FS                          
204        default y                                  
205        help                                       
206          Choose Y here to disable the use of N    
207          on modern networks (1Gb+) can lead to    
208          fragmentation during high loads.         
209                                                   
210 config NFS_V4_2_READ_PLUS                         
211         bool "NFS: Enable support for the NFSv    
212         depends on NFS_V4_2                       
213         default y                                 
214         help                                      
215          Choose Y here to enable use of the NF    
                                                      

~ [ source navigation ] ~ [ diff markup ] ~ [ identifier search ] ~

kernel.org | git.kernel.org | LWN.net | Project Home | SVN repository | Mail admin

Linux® is a registered trademark of Linus Torvalds in the United States and other countries.
TOMOYO® is a registered trademark of NTT DATA CORPORATION.

sflogo.php